A concurrent force system is composed of the following forces: Force O is 500 N and is directed up to the right with a slope of 2V to 3H. Force L is 560 N and is directed to the right. Force A is 620 N and is directed down to the right with a slope of 5V to 12H. Force G is 730 N and is directed down to the left at 36° with the horizontal. Force E is 820 N and is directed up to the left at 65° with the vertical.
Calculate the angle that the resultant force makes with the x-axis in degrees.
